Ra was good in the manga because the author could just add new effects to Ra to give it whatever it needed to be a massive threat in the current gamestate.
>When Odion Summoned the counterfeit copy, he revealed that this monster took on the ATK/DEF of the monsters that were Tributed to Tribute Summon it.
>Each turn this monster was Summoned against Yami Yugi, it revealed a different effect/part of a previous effect. The first time, it revealed that this monster's Phoenix Mode was immune to destruction, and its destruction effect can destroy another God card. The second time, Yami Marik revealed that he could Tribute monsters to increase this monster's ATK/DEF by those of the Tributes monster's. The third time, in the manga only, it was revealed that even in Battle Mode, this monster was immune to the attacks and effects of Gods that were lower in rank

But it has, the special stat in gen 1 was used for both special attack and defense, so blissey was a literal monster. They split the stat into two starting from gen 2, introduced abilites in gen 3, and then in gen 4 they made the physical/special split when it comes to moves, so entire types aren't considered special or physical (ie fire is special, rock is physical), each move has its own quirks.
